package org.apache.lucene.codecs.memory;
import java.io.IOException;
import org.apache.lucene.index.SortedSetDocValues;
import org.apache.lucene.index.TermsEnum;
import org.apache.lucene.util.BytesRef;
/**
* A per-document set of presorted byte[] values.
* <p>
* Per-Document values in a SortedDocValues are deduplicated, dereferenced,
* and sorted into a dictionary of unique values. A pointer to the
* dictionary value (ordinal) can be retrieved for each document. Ordinals
* are dense and in increasing sorted order.
*
* @deprecated Use {@link SortedSetDocValues} instead.
*/
@Deprecated
abstract class LegacySortedSetDocValues {
/** Sole constructor. (For invocation by subclass
* constructors, typically implicit.) */
protected LegacySortedSetDocValues() {}
/** When returned by {@link #nextOrd()} it means there are no more
* ordinals for the document.
*/
public static final long NO_MORE_ORDS = -1;
/**
* Returns the next ordinal for the current document (previously
* set by {@link #setDocument(int)}.
* @return next ordinal for the document, or {@link #NO_MORE_ORDS}.
* ordinals are dense, start at 0, then increment by 1 for
* the next value in sorted order.
*/
public abstract long nextOrd();
/**
* Sets iteration to the specified docID
* @param docID document ID
*/
public abstract void setDocument(int docID);
/** Retrieves the value for the specified ordinal. The returned
* {@link BytesRef} may be re-used across calls to lookupOrd so make sure to
* {@link BytesRef#deepCopyOf(BytesRef) copy it} if you want to keep it
* around.
* @param ord ordinal to lookup
* @see #nextOrd
*/
public abstract BytesRef lookupOrd(long ord);
/**
* Returns the number of unique values.
* @return number of unique values in this SortedDocValues. This is
* also equivalent to one plus the maximum ordinal.
*/
public abstract long getValueCount();
/** If {@code key} exists, returns its ordinal, else
* returns {@code -insertionPoint-1}, like {@code
* Arrays.binarySearch}.
*
* @param key Key to look up
**/
public long lookupTerm(BytesRef key) {
long low = 0;
long high = getValueCount()-1;
while (low <= high) {
long mid = (low + high) >>> 1;
final BytesRef term = lookupOrd(mid);
int cmp = term.compareTo(key);
if (cmp < 0) {
low = mid + 1;
} else if (cmp > 0) {
high = mid - 1;
} else {
return mid; // key found
}
}
return -(low + 1); // key not found.
}
/**
* Returns a {@link TermsEnum} over the values.
* The enum supports {@link TermsEnum#ord()} and {@link TermsEnum#seekExact(long)}.
*/
public TermsEnum termsEnum() throws IOException {
throw new UnsupportedOperationException();
}
}
